What the job involves:We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Reliability Engineering Intern to join our team. The intern will work with the Reliability Engineering lead to manage and expand predictive maintenance program, operationalize preventive maintenance program, and perform root cause analysis for system/equipment failures.As an Intern in Engineering at JLL, you will:Review and improve Preventive Maintenance Routines and Predictive Maintenance Tasks for enhanced facility reliabilityPerform Failure Root Cause Analysis on critical equipment to identify areas for improvementLead and execute Six Sigma continuous improvement projects for increased efficiency and effectivenessDevelop and implement a comprehensive equipment reliability programConduct reliability audits and assessments to identify potential issues and recommend proactive solutionsCollaborate with cross-functional teams to develop and implement reliability-centered maintenance strategiesProgram DetailsDates: June 1, 2026 – August 14, 2026Location: Chesterfield and Creve Coeur, MOEducation, Skills, And ExperienceActively pursuing a bachelor’s degree, with 2-3 years completed majoring in Mechanical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, or any other Engineering and/or Facilities Management. Understanding of engineering principles and mechanics, knowledge of maintenance and reliability concepts, and familiarity with relevant software/tools for analyzing equipment performance. Ability to conduct data analysis, identify trends, and make data-driven decisions. Proficiency in tools such as Excel, database management, and statistical analysis software can be beneficial. Capability to identify root causes of equipment failures, propose effective solutions, and implement corrective actions to minimize downtime and improve reliability. Strong verbal and written communication skills to effectively collaborate with team members, present findings, and explain compl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ders. Ability to pay close attention to small details, perform thorough equipment inspections, and follow established maintenance and reliability protocols. Experience in managing projects, coordinating with multiple stakeholders, setting priorities, and delivering results within specified timelines. Willingness to learn and apply new knowledge, actively seek opportunities for process improvement, and contribute to the development of efficiency-enhancing strategies. Collaboration skills to work effectively with team members from various departments and levels of the organization, while exhibiting a positive and cooperative attitude. Proficiency with Microsoft Office ApplicationsDesire to learn more about our industryThe ideal candidate should be prepared to work in a fast-paced team environment and will finish the internship having gained broad experience in various aspects of Commercial Real Estate.
